What the import establishes, and what it deliberately does not:
| Certifier + status | ✅ from official published lists (source hierarchy level 1) |
| Certificate attributes (glatt, pas yisrael…) | ❌ absent from the sources → attributes = {}, i.e. unknown |
| Expiry dates | ❌ absent → valid_until = NULL; per-certifier freshness governs staleness |
| Level (regular / mehadrin) | ❌ not published in these lists → unknown |
So a profile requiring any attribute resolves to UNKNOWN against seed records — never
MATCH. Rows the corpus flagged needs_review (ambiguous poster layout) get PENDING
certificates so they cannot serve a MATCH before a moderator sees them. Certificate
photos and field verification are what upgrade these records later.
Every run writes an ingestion_run row (including dry runs — reviews leave a trail) and
an audit_log entry per created or changed record, with the source document as evidence.
Re-running is safe: restaurants upsert on dedupe_key, certificates on import_key.
